Students pursuing an MD/MA in Public Policy at the University of Chicago usually finish their initial three years of medical studies before taking a year off to focus entirely on graduate coursework at the Harris School of Public Policy. After this policy-focused year, MD/MA candidates resume their medical training at the Pritzker School of Medicine to complete their last clinical year. In this final phase of medical school, students have the option to take supplementary elective courses at the policy school. Most MD/MA candidates successfully complete both degree programs within a five-year timeframe.

Qualification Requirements

You may submit unofficial transcripts through the electronic application process. Official transcripts will be required upon admission only for enrolling students. Please submit transcripts for all prior academic work from any institution of higher education. Three (3) Letters of Recommendation We are looking letters of recommendation that speak to your professional or academic ability. Recommenders should submit letters through the electronic application. Minimum TOEFL Score - 95 total Minimum IELTS Score - 7.0 overall, no less than 7.0 on each section
